    Tool is different.
    You’re used to the singer being forward in the mix. Tool mixes the vocals as an equal instrument. A part of the band. only forward when the song demands it-the music isnt a separate element. Even when they play live Maynard, the singer, is staged in the back on a platform near the drummer. Bass and guitar are staged in the front.
